    President Trump Honors Jocelyn Nungaray by Renaming Wildlife Refuge

    On March 5, 2025, President Donald J. Trump signed an Executive Order to rename the Anahuac National Wildlife Refuge as the “Jocelyn Nungaray National Refuge”

    In memory of twelve-year-old Jocelyn Nungaray, who was murdered in Houston, Texas, in June 2024. The article discusses the circumstances surrounding her death, including the alleged involvement of two individuals linked to a gang and criticism of the previous administration’s immigration policies, which are believed to have contributed to rising crime rates.

    The article further examines the Trump administration’s stance on immigration, suggesting that prior policies led to an increase in criminal activity at the southern border. It claims that under President Biden’s leadership, the border was perceived as less secure, resulting in an uptick in illegal immigration and associated crime rates.

    In contrast, the Trump administration highlights its initiatives to restore border security through various measures, such as deploying military personnel, resuming border wall construction, and implementing stricter immigration policies.

    To address border issues, the administration has introduced several strategies aimed at enhancing security and reducing illegal crossings. These include designating certain cartels as terrorist organizations, suspending the entry of specific individuals, and revoking previous executive actions from the Biden administration.

    The article concludes by emphasizing the administration’s commitment to ensuring safety and sovereignty at the border while honoring Jocelyn Nungaray.

    President Trump Takes Steps to Enhance Government Efficiency and Accountability

    On March 5, 2025, President Trump announced several initiatives aimed at reducing inefficiencies within the federal government.

    These measures include the establishment of the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E), tasked with maximizing productivity and ensuring responsible use of taxpayer funds. The administration claims that these efforts have already resulted in billions of dollars in savings for taxpayers.

    Among the key actions taken, the President has mandated that federal workers return to the office full-time and has implemented hiring restrictions to control workforce expansion. Additionally, he has terminated contracts and programs deemed wasteful, including the Federal Executive Institute and the Climate Corps, while also pausing foreign aid grants to enhance accountability. These reforms are part of a broader strategy to eliminate what the administration describes as waste, fraud, and abuse within federal agencies.

    The administration is also scrutinizing grants and funding for non-governmental organizations to ensure taxpayer money is not used for initiatives that do not align with American interests. A review identified approximately 15,000 grants worth $60 billion for potential elimination. Overall, these efforts aim to restructure the federal government to better serve taxpayers and increase operational efficiency.

    First Lady Melania Trump Advocates for Online Protection of Children at Capitol Hill Roundtable

    On March 3, 2025, First Lady Melania Trump, U.S. Senator Ted Cruz, and U.S. Representative Maria Salazar hosted a roundtable discussion on online protection for children at Capitol Hill. The event gathered Members of Congress, survivors of non-consensual intimate imagery (NCII), and online safety advocates to discuss the Take It Down Act, a bipartisan bill designed to empower victims to have harmful images removed from the internet quickly. In her opening remarks, the First Lady expressed her commitment to making the internet a safer space for young Americans, particularly highlighting the challenges posed by harmful online content.

    During her speech, Mrs. Trump emphasized the emotional and psychological toll that harmful online content can have on young people, especially girls. She urged the House of Representatives to swiftly pass the Take It Down Act, which had already received Senate approval. Senator Cruz and online safety advocates echoed her sentiments, stressing the importance of legislative action to ensure that victims receive the necessary support to remove damaging images from the internet.

    The discussion highlighted the urgent need for federal legislation that prioritizes the well-being of children in the digital age. Advocates, including Francesca Mani and Elliston Berry, shared personal stories to illustrate the bill’s significance and its potential impact on victims’ lives. The Take It Down Act aims to provide tangible protection by allowing victims to remove harmful images within a specific timeframe, thereby enhancing online safety for all young users.
